mirror of
https://codeberg.org/guix/guix.git
synced 2025-10-02 02:15:12 +00:00
gnu: Add python-docker-5.
This is a followup to commit 3eb1ceac58
along
with an upcoming commit to use this in docker-compose to fully fix it. This
package is added just for the old version 1 of docker-compose and should be
removed once Docker is updated (which includes "docker compose" v2 built-in).
* gnu/packages/docker.scm (python-docker-5): New variable.
Change-Id: I9e640ca3a87fb6e055524cd5acc79588ac36fe36
This commit is contained in:
parent
96e37a6742
commit
8d53a08852
1 changed files with 28 additions and 0 deletions
|
@ -11,6 +11,7 @@
|
||||||
;;; Copyright © 2024 Nicolas Graves <ngraves@ngraves.fr>
|
;;; Copyright © 2024 Nicolas Graves <ngraves@ngraves.fr>
|
||||||
;;; Copyright © 2025 Artyom V. Poptsov <poptsov.artyom@gmail.com>
|
;;; Copyright © 2025 Artyom V. Poptsov <poptsov.artyom@gmail.com>
|
||||||
;;; Copyright © 2025 Vinicius Monego <monego@posteo.net>
|
;;; Copyright © 2025 Vinicius Monego <monego@posteo.net>
|
||||||
|
;;; Copyright © 2025 John Kehayias <john.kehayias@protonmail.com>
|
||||||
;;;
|
;;;
|
||||||
;;; This file is part of GNU Guix.
|
;;; This file is part of GNU Guix.
|
||||||
;;;
|
;;;
|
||||||
|
@ -103,6 +104,33 @@
|
||||||
management tool.")
|
management tool.")
|
||||||
(license license:asl2.0)))
|
(license license:asl2.0)))
|
||||||
|
|
||||||
|
;; Needed for old v1 of docker-compose; remove once Docker is updated to a
|
||||||
|
;; more recent version which has the command "docker compose" built-in.
|
||||||
|
(define-public python-docker-5
|
||||||
|
(package
|
||||||
|
(inherit python-docker)
|
||||||
|
(name "python-docker")
|
||||||
|
(version "5.0.3")
|
||||||
|
(source
|
||||||
|
(origin
|
||||||
|
(method git-fetch)
|
||||||
|
(uri (git-reference
|
||||||
|
(url "https://github.com/docker/docker-py")
|
||||||
|
(commit version)))
|
||||||
|
(file-name (git-file-name name version))
|
||||||
|
(sha256
|
||||||
|
(base32 "0m5ifgxdhcf7yci0ncgnxjas879sksrf3im0fahs573g268farz9"))))
|
||||||
|
(build-system python-build-system)
|
||||||
|
;; Integration tests need a running Docker daemon.
|
||||||
|
(arguments (list #:tests? #f))
|
||||||
|
(native-inputs '())
|
||||||
|
(inputs (modify-inputs (package-inputs python-docker)
|
||||||
|
(prepend python-six)
|
||||||
|
(delete "python-urllib3")))
|
||||||
|
(propagated-inputs
|
||||||
|
(modify-inputs (package-propagated-inputs python-docker)
|
||||||
|
(prepend python-docker-pycreds python-urllib3-1.26)))))
|
||||||
|
|
||||||
(define-public python-dockerpty
|
(define-public python-dockerpty
|
||||||
(package
|
(package
|
||||||
(name "python-dockerpty")
|
(name "python-dockerpty")
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ue